New York — Northwell Health, the largest healthcare provider and private employer in New York state, is on a path of significant expansion and growth under the leadership of CEO Michael Dowling. With more than 28 hospitals and approximately 900 outpatient care centers across downstate New York and Connecticut, Northwell Health’s operations have recently been boosted by its merger with Connecticut’s Nuvance Health in April 2021.
Michael Dowling, who has been with Northwell since its formation in 1995 and has served as CEO since 2002, has led the organization to achieve a remarkable valuation of $23 billion. His leadership emphasizes the importance of strong relationships and values integral to the healthcare industry, such as integrity, respect, and tolerance.
With an employee count exceeding 104,000, Northwell Health operates under a strategy that focuses on integrating healthcare services and expanding access to care. Dowling believes that large healthcare systems are crucial in effectively meeting the needs of both underserved and well-served populations. His vision includes acquiring and expanding previously underserved hospitals to enhance healthcare accessibility throughout the region.
Northwell Health is not only concerned with operational growth but also allocates federal funding for research and public health initiatives. The organization prioritizes inclusivity by providing comprehensive transgender care, demonstrating its commitment to a diverse patient demographic. Northwell has also been active in community outreach, including urban agricultural initiatives such as Harlem Grown, which provides mental health services and food resources to local communities.
In light of current political dynamics, Dowling has expressed his concerns regarding the federal government’s approach to global health initiatives, critiquing policies that diminish U.S. involvement. He advocates for improved reimbursement for Medicaid to ensure that all individuals have access to necessary medical services.
While discussing the New York Health Act, Dowling expressed reservations about its financial viability and the potential for delayed care, reflecting concerns based on international healthcare systems he has observed. He encourages the growth of large health systems to support effective healthcare delivery and patient access while maintaining operational sustainability.
The integration of Nuvance Health is projected to involve a substantial investment of $1 billion, aimed at enhancing patient care quality and adhering to existing healthcare regulations and agreements. Dowling’s commitment to collaborative culture within Northwell has resulted in a focus on teamwork, celebrating the achievements of his staff rather than seeking individual recognition.
Innovatively, Northwell Health has ventured into the production industry by launching Northwell Studios, a facility aimed at creating medical-themed media content. This initiative seeks to both inform the public and elevate the profile of Northwell’s healthcare offerings, which can assist in recruitment efforts. Current projects include scripted shows and docu-style content designed to engage diverse audiences while adhering to ethical filming practices that respect patient involvement.
